This season, I have been all about monochromatic looks (i.e. wearing items in shades of the same hue) and in particular, have been dreaming up variations of all grey looks.  Brighter than wearing all black, but more understated than wearing winter whites, there’s just something so chic, but subtle about an all grey look and in my opinion, the color compliments all skin tones.

I recently purchased an off-the-shoulder bodycon grey knit dress that is just the right tightness and shortness to not fall into the homely sweater dress pile (don’t get me wrong, I like those too, just not for Sunday Funday in the MPD) and I couldn’t wait to wear it with my favorite over-the-knee grey suede boots.  To keep the hue of the outfit consistent, I wore a pair of grey tights for warmth (bare legs during the winter are not advisable). For a little winter touch and extra coverage to save me from becoming the too naked girl at brunch, I draped a grey rabbit fur wrap around my neck and held it in place (while highlighting my waist) with a gold buckled tan belt.   To compliment the belt, I used a tan Valentino satchel with gold hardware.  For accessories, I wore my favorite chunky square sunglasses and new gorgeous studded and pyramid bracelets from Nandel Paris that Bugsy bought me for Christmas.

Fashion tip:  If you don’t want to buy a fur vest and want an item that is more versatile (or can’t afford a fur vest because they tend to be pricey), try buying a wide faux or real fur wrap or scarf.  In this way you can wrap it around your neck as a scarf, drape it outside of your jacket to add an instant fur collar or belt it (like I did with this outfit) to give it a vest effect.
